Analysis

In 2020, females, as a share of private paid employees by wage quintile in Colombia stood at 0.4773.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 14.2% on the previous year and down 11.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, females, as a share of private paid employees by wage quintile in Colombia peaked at 0.5687 in 2016 and was at its lowest, 0.4423, in 2002.

Colombia ranks 46th of 60 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 18 years of available data.

Females, as a share of private paid employees by wage quintile in Colombia, year by year

Annual values for Females, as a share of private paid employees by wage quintile: Quintile 1 in Colombia, 2001 to 2020.
Year Value Change
2001 0.4961
2002 0.4423 -10.8%
2003 0.4861 +9.9%
2004 0.4858 -0.0%
2005 0.5031 +3.6%
2006 0.4613 -8.3%
2007 0.4604 -0.2%
2008 0.4993 +8.4%
2009 0.5085 +1.8%
2010 0.5399 +6.2%
2011 0.5368 -0.6%
2012 0.5439 +1.3%
2013 0.5421 -0.3%
2014 0.5544 +2.3%
2015 0.5629 +1.5%
2016 0.5687 +1.0%
2017 0.5562 -2.2%
2020 0.4773 -14.2%
